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
263 32054700 46
1251 5333809
1251 5333809
5248 412 01811
All about undefined
Interested in learning more?
1251 5333809
5248 412 01811
See more
09119958 492 871685
9693 963 789 92
See more
233968611 6470697338 36430
747 0580301 4921128621
See more